✨Hamstring Muscle ✨
The hamstrings, located along the back of your thighs, play a key role in hip extension and knee flexion — essential for walking, running, and maintaining good posture. These muscles connect your pelvis to the lower leg bones, working together to stabilize your hips and support smooth, powerful movement.
However, when the hamstrings become tight or overworked from prolonged sitting or pelvic misalignment, it can lead to:
✔️Lower back discomfort
✔️Hip or knee pain
✔️Reduced flexibility
✔️Muscle strains or tension during activity
